Essential Information About the Ibanez S721RB Guitar
- Iron Label Spirit: a completely "blacked out" look and design focused on modern metal sounds, direct and no-frills.
- Wizard III 5-piece Maple/Walnut Neck: thin, fast, and comfortable profile, ideal for technical playing and fast runs on 24 frets.
- Dual DiMarzio D Activator Humbuckers: sharp attack, very tight lows, and excellent definition under heavy distortion.
- Stage/Studio Reliability: Gotoh MG-T locking tuners, Gibraltar Standard III bridge, and luminescent side dot inlays for confident playing even in the dark.
Iron Label x S Series: a radical version of an iconic Ibanez design
The S series is known for its "form and function" approach: a fast-to-play, lightweight instrument designed for modern playing. With the Iron Label version, Ibanez takes the concept further by aiming for a sober and aggressive aesthetic, as well as a configuration clearly oriented towards heavy tone. The S721RB fits this philosophy: everything on the guitar serves playability, tuning stability, and sonic efficiency.
Who is the S721RB made for? From heavy rhythms to precise solos
With its Wizard III neck, 24 frets, and construction designed for speed, the S721RB is especially aimed at intermediate to advanced guitarists who want a responsive electric guitar made for chaining palm-muted riffs, fast alternate picking, tapping, and highly articulated leads. Naturally comfortable in metal (modern, prog, metalcore, djent), it is equally relevant in energetic rock whenever a clear attack, solid tuning stability, and a "fast" playing feel are sought. The 5-way selector allows exploring several tonal nuances around the two humbuckers, handy for switching from a big rhythm wall to sharper, more defined sounds.
A tight, powerful, and clear sound designed for high gain
The okoumé body provides a lively response, with a register that remains clear and "solid": it's a good playground for maintaining definition when pushing the gain. The ebony fingerboard enhances this sense of precision, with firm lows, present mids, and a marked attack, while promoting a quick response and rich sustain for solos. On the amplification side, the DiMarzio D Activator (passive humbuckers) are designed to deliver a generous output level while keeping an open and clean sound in articulation: harmonics come out easily, lows stay tight, and complex chords retain good clarity. Finally, the combination of the Gibraltar Standard III bridge and neck design contributes to efficient vibration transfer, with a feeling of stability and control particularly appreciated in standard tuning and heavy rhythm playing.
Recommended Compatible Accessories
To maintain the original feel and balance, opt for a set of D'Addario EXL110 strings with gauges .010/.013/.017/.026/.036/.046 (same as factory setup). This is a safe choice for this 6-string guitar with a 25.5" / 648 mm scale length, ideal for keeping a familiar tension in standard tuning.
Technical specifications
| Left handed | No | Nbr of strings | 6 |
| Strings | Steel | Color | Black |
| Category | Iron Label | Neck thickness at 12th fret | 21 mm / 0.83" |
| Series | S | Scale length | 25.5" / 648 mm |
| Number of strings | 6 | Nut width | 43 mm / 1.7" |
| Body wood | okoumé | Fingerboard width at end | 58 mm / 2.28" |
| Top (solid body) | none | Fingerboard | ebony |
| Body finish | satin polyurethane | Radius | 15.75" / 400 mm |
| Total length | 985 mm / 38.78" | Number of frets | 24 |
| Body length | 449 mm / 17.68" | Fret type | jumbo |
| Body width | 318 mm / 12.52" | Side markers | luminescent side dot inlay |
| Body thickness | 38 mm / 1.50" | Bridge | Gibraltar Standard III |
| Neck type | Wizard III | String spacing | 10.8 mm / 0.43" |
| Construction | bolt-on | Tuners | Gotoh MG-T locking machine heads |
| Neck wood | 5-piece maple/walnut | Nut | plastic |
| Neck finish | satin polyurethane | Hardware color | black |
| Neck thickness at 1st fret | 19 mm / 0.75" | ||
Questions frequently asked
Is the Ibanez S721RB Iron Label suitable for modern metal?
This model combines two passive DiMarzio D Activator humbuckers with an ebony fingerboard, delivering tight lows and a pronounced attack under high gain. Its 24 jumbo frets and Wizard III neck support fast riffs, tapping, and articulate leads.
What neck does this Ibanez S guitar feature?
The bolt-on Wizard III neck is made of five-piece maple/walnut and measures 19 mm at the 1st fret, then 21 mm at the 12th fret. Its satin finish and 400 mm radius accommodate a fast playing style.
Can multiple tones be obtained with the two humbuckers?
The 5-way selector allows exploration of different shades around the two DiMarzio D Activator pickups, from thick rhythm sounds to more defined tones.
Is the bridge equipped with a tremolo?
The guitar features a fixed Gibraltar Standard III bridge paired with Gotoh MG-T locking tuners. This setup is designed for tuning stability in standard tuning and strong rhythmic playing.
Which strings should be chosen to keep the original setup?
A set of D’Addario EXL110 in .010/.013/.017/.026/.036/.046 matches the specified string gauge. The 648 mm scale length and six steel strings are designed for this tension in standard tuning.
